2010-08-05 13 views
3

J'aime le paquet TODO dans textmate. Lorsque je le lance cependant, il recherche ce qui semble être mon disque entier. Y a-t-il un moyen que je peux dire pour simplement rechercher, par exemple, mon dossier de projets? Ou mieux encore, le dossier du projet actuellement ouvert?Textmate, Comment limiter les recherches de paquets TODO de dossiers quand il se lance?

Cet article, Textmate: Taming TODOs and FIXMEs, vous montre comment le faire ignorer un dossier,

Je me demandais s'il y avait un moyen de définir un dossier cible pour todo à analyser?

Merci

Répondre

0

J'utilise le faisceau de todo de Stanley Rost - Dernière modification le 6 janvier 2010 et installé grâce au faisceau de grands GetBundles.

Si rien n'est sélectionné dans le panneau de projet, TODO recherche dans le projet: Si des dossiers ou des fichiers sont sélectionnés dans le panneau de projet, alors TODO ne les recherche que pour eux. Notez qu'il existe également un panneau de filtre dans la fenêtre de liste TODO.

HTH

Antoine

2

En textmate2 vous pouvez définir la variable TM_TODO_IGNORE dans .tm_properties, Souhaitée définir des exceptions TODO sur une base de projet. Ce devrait être une expression régulière. Exemple:

TM_TODO_IGNORE = '/(disabled(-src)?|onig-.*|build|cache|CxxTest|(FScript|BWToolkitFramework).framework)/'

Il est également possible de définir TM_TODO_IGNORE dans Préférences> Variables, même expression rationnelle.